1. Introduction
About the software
SoFA is a newly-developed simple program based on Matlab, for the calculation of bearing
capacity and settlements of shallow foundations. Correct calculation of ultimate bearing
capacity and foundation settlement is the most crucial step in the design of shallow
foundations. Analytical solutions are preferred to numerical methods (i.e. complex finite
element models) in engineering practice, mainly because of their inherent simplicity. In this
stand-alone program, safety factors are calculated for the ultimate bearing capacity using
several well-known formulas from the literature. Short-term components of settlements are
calculated using the adjusted elasticity method, and confined one-dimensional deformation
of the soil is assumed for the consolidation. The newly-developed software provides
solutions for all three design approaches implemented in Eurocode 7, as well as in
Eurocode 8 for earthquake loading. Cohesive and cohesionless soils, static and dynamic
loads, drained and undrained conditions are examined. Our program has a simple userfriendly graphical interface. It is freely distributed and well documented in order to attract
engineers to exploit its capabilities.

Licensing information
This program is copyrighted ( K. Nikolaou) under the GNU General Public License as
published by the Free Software Foundation, version 2. In short, you can employ them freely
(assuming you cite the original source and the relevant publication) but if you want to build
upon, extend or re-distribute it, then the derivative software products will also have to be covered
under the GPL (i.e., be free software).

3. How to perform a static bearing capacity check


1. Open SoFA

Figure 1 - main form

2. Input your problem data

Geometry of the problem


o select a rectangular or strip foundation
o footing dimensions
o depth of foundation
o depth of water level (you are allowed to set it infinite)
o footing base inclination
o soil inclination
Soil properties

5. How to perform a settlement calculation


1. Open SoFA

Figure 6 - main form

2. Input your problem data

Geometry of the problem


o select a rectangular or strip foundation
o footing dimensions
o depth of foundation
o depth of water level (you are allowed to set it infinite)

Soil properties
o select a cohesive or cohesionless soil

Loads (only static loads are used for settlement calculation)

o Vertical load applied

Settlement data
o Modulus of elasticity (E)
o Poisons ratio (n)
o Stratum thickness (H)
For cohesive soils, the following are also required
o Over consolidation ratio (OCR)
o Void ratio (eo)
o Cc factor

3. Press Settlements Button (for graphical results) or View Report (for textual results)

Figure 7 - Immediate, due to consolidation and total settlements
